Why shared discount codes do not work at scale
A single shared code seems simple. One code, unlimited uses, mass distribution. This breaks down when the code spreads beyond your target audience.
Shopify allows shared codes, but once distributed publicly, they are impossible to control. Shared codes get posted to coupon sites within hours. Your 20% off code for first-time customers now works for everyone. Margins shrink. Customer acquisition costs spike.
Problems with shared codes:
- No tracking per customer or channel
- Impossible to limit who uses the code
- Can’t revoke access after distribution
- No way to prevent coupon site abuse
- Zero insight into code sharing behavior
Unique codes give control. One code per customer means you can track, limit, and revoke access when needed.
Shopify limitations for large discount campaigns
Shopify’s admin lets you create discount codes one at a time. Fine for testing. Unusable for campaigns with 10,000+ codes.
The discount admin has no bulk creation option. No CSV import. No practical API workflow for safely creating large volumes without custom infrastructure.
Shopify limits:
- Manual creation only through admin UI
- No built-in bulk import functionality
- Rate limits on discount API calls
- Long processing times for large batches
- Complex API requirements for batch operations
Creating 50,000 codes manually would take weeks. Using the API directly requires handling rate limits, retries, and error management.

How bulk discount code generation works
Bulk generation creates unique codes and registers them with Shopify’s discount system.
The process:
- Define discount parameters (type, amount, dates)
- Generate or import unique code list
- Upload codes in batches to Shopify
- Handle API rate limits and errors
- Verify all codes created successfully
- Export final code list for distribution
Good tools handle the API complexity. You focus on campaign setup and distribution. The app manages batch processing, retries, and error handling.

Common use cases for bulk discount codes
Influencer campaigns
Generate a unique code for each creator. Track which influencers drive sales and revoke individual codes if terms are violated.
Customer acquisition
Distribute codes through paid ads, partnerships, or direct mail. Channel-specific prefixes make tracking straightforward. One-time use limits prevent sharing.
Packaging inserts
Print unique codes on product packaging or receipts to encourage repeat purchases. Track redemption rates by product line.
Referral programs
Give existing customers unique codes to pass on. Reward both the referrer and the new customer. Top referrers show up clearly in your redemption data.
Events and trade shows
Pre-generate codes for attendee swag bags. Track redemption by event to measure actual ROI rather than guessing.
B2B and wholesale
Create customer-specific codes for different pricing tiers. The right customer uses the right discount, and unauthorized sharing is easy to spot.
Best practices for generating and distributing codes
Use campaign-specific prefixes (LAUNCH24-, REFER-, VIP-) so you can filter and analyze results by campaign later.
Enable profanity filtering. Randomly generated codes occasionally spell something inappropriate. Better to catch that before distribution.
Set usage limits based on how widely the code will spread. One-time use for broad campaigns. A small limit for VIPs. The wider the audience, the stricter the limit.
Monitor redemption by channel. Cut what’s not working early, and run more of what is.
Set expiration dates. Time limits create urgency and make campaign cleanup easier afterward.
Don’t post codes publicly. Email, direct mail, or authenticated downloads keeps codes off coupon sites far longer than a public link does.
Test on a small batch first. Generate ten codes, verify the discount logic works as expected, then scale up.
